2.3 Maximum delivery time
Unless we have expressly agreed a different date with you, we will deliver your order within 30 days of the contract being concluded, under Article 109 of the Spanish Consumer Protection Act (Royal Legislative Decree 1/2007).
If that deadline passes and you have not received your order, you may ask us to deliver within an additional period appropriate to the circumstances. If we fail to deliver within that additional period, you are entitled to terminate the contract, and we will refund everything you paid without undue delay.

5. Customs, duties and import taxes outside the European Union
This section matters if your delivery address is outside the European Union.
The price you pay us covers the goods and the shipping service. It does not include any customs duties, import taxes or clearance fees applied in your country.
Where such charges apply, they are set by the authorities of the destination country, they are payable by you as the importer, and they are outside our control. Carriers usually collect them before or at delivery, and some add their own handling fee.
We cannot tell you in advance what these charges will be, as they depend on your country's rules and thresholds. If you are unsure, your national customs service can tell you what applies to printed books and similar goods.
We do not declare goods at a lower value than their sale price, and we do not mark commercial shipments as gifts.
